On Thu, Mar 09 2017, David Bremner <david@tethera.net> wrote:
> Jani Nikula <jani@nikula.org> writes:
>
>> notmuch-show-stash-date stashes the Date: header of the message
>> verbatim. While that is useful, sometimes more control of the output
>> is desirable.
>>
>> Add support for stashing the message timestamp (as parsed by gmime at
>> the lib level from the Date: header) according to a user customizable
>> format. The user can use this to stash the message date in the
>> preferred format, or perhaps as a date: range query, for example
>> "date:@%s.." to find all messages since the current message.
